Hadoop入门之专家指引

2025-01-01 22:49:03   小编

Hadoop入门之专家指引

在当今大数据时代,Hadoop作为一款强大的分布式存储和计算框架,正受到越来越多的关注和应用。对于想要踏入大数据领域的初学者来说,了解Hadoop的基础知识至关重要。

Hadoop的核心在于其分布式文件系统(HDFS)和MapReduce计算模型。HDFS将大规模的数据分散存储在多个节点上,通过冗余备份保证数据的可靠性和高可用性。这使得它能够高效地处理海量数据,克服了传统存储方式在面对大数据时的局限性。

MapReduce则是Hadoop的计算引擎。它将复杂的计算任务分解为Map和Reduce两个阶段。Map阶段负责对数据进行并行处理,将数据映射为键值对;Reduce阶段则对Map阶段的结果进行汇总和合并,最终得到计算结果。这种分而治之的思想大大提高了数据处理的效率。

要开始学习Hadoop,首先需要搭建一个适合的开发环境。这包括安装Hadoop软件包、配置相关的环境变量等。了解Hadoop的基本命令和操作也是必不可少的,例如如何创建文件、目录,如何上传和下载数据等。

在掌握了基本操作后,可以通过一些简单的实例来深入理解Hadoop的工作原理。比如编写一个简单的MapReduce程序,对一组数据进行统计分析。通过实践,不仅可以加深对Hadoop的理解,还能提高自己的编程能力。

学习Hadoop还需要关注其生态系统。Hadoop生态系统包含了许多相关的工具和技术,如Hive、Pig、HBase等。这些工具可以帮助我们更方便地进行数据处理和分析,拓宽Hadoop的应用场景。

对于初学者来说,学习Hadoop可能会遇到一些困难和挑战。但只要保持学习的热情,多实践、多探索,逐步积累经验,就一定能够掌握Hadoop的核心知识和技能,为今后在大数据领域的发展打下坚实的基础。在大数据的浪潮中,Hadoop无疑是一座值得攀登的高峰,让我们一起踏上这趟探索之旅。

TAGS: 大数据入门 专家指引 Hadoop学习 Hadoop入门

欢迎使用万千站长工具!

Welcome to www.zzTool.com